HC Deb 11 November 1996 vol 285 c19W
Mr. Cox

To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s what representations he plans to make to the Governments of Latvia, Lithuania, Ukraine and Russia concerning(a) the abolition of the death penalty and (b) resolution 1097 (1996) of the Parliamentary Assembly of the Council of Europe; and if he will make a statement. [2745]

Mr. Hanley

The European Union made a demarche to Ukraine on 31 October, and to Russia on 4 November, encouraging them to fulfil commitments made to the Council of Europe to introduce moratoriums on the death penalty. The Presidents of Latvia and Lithuania have declared moratoriums on the death penalty pending parliamentary discussion of its abolition.
